QUAZAR Helps Buyers Avoid Luxury Fakes
News Source : Ubergizmo
News Summary
- Korean startup wants shoppers, resellers, and retailers to use guided smartphone photos to identify counterfeits.
- CEO Myunghyun Kim says guided photos are important for luxury authentication.
- QUAZAR says it has built a large genuine-and-counterfeit image dataset and reported 94.5% detection accuracy in testing.
- Its investor deck lists a Hyundai Department Store proof of concept and discussions with other retail and resale partners.
- The company was founded in 2020 and began with luxury authentication before expanding its pitch toward a broader “physical intelligence” platform.
QUAZAR is betting that a luxury handbags stitching, hardware, logo placement, and even tiny surface details can become more useful than a serialnumber tag.
